Tolls from Spalding to Donington

Bill Hunter’s poster is advertising an auction at the White Hart Inn in Spalding on March 18, 1863.

The tolls were on the turnpike road from Spalding to Donington at Pinchbeck, Lingar House and Crossgate Bars, and Spalding Chain, to be let in one lot to the best bidder for a year. There were exemptions, such as carriages carrying manure. The tolls had totalled £603 the previous year, so was a lucrative operation.
